Overview
 

As an Analyst, you will have the opportunity to influence the functional strategy and related deliveries from “Day One” while designing the functional blueprints and related requirements to expand upon our digital and automated Client Onboarding platform to grow revenue and reduce friction (costs/manual processes). We are looking for a hands-on Vice President Senior Product Owner/Lead Business Analyst to join our Business Platforms and Process Automation team with experience leading teams and interfacing with stakeholders to solve the complex Client Onboarding challenges that Deutsche Bank’s Corporate Bank faces today. The aim is to create a single product agnostic global Client Onboarding platform with self-service capability for the clients to request new deals and get setup quickly in order to transact. You will be providing functional requirements to build components of our single-user interface portal, our key-stone technology platform that is both internal and external client-facing. Within the Corporate Bank, you will support solutions that enable liquidity management, payments, trade finance, lending, and institutional cash and securities services for corporate and financial institution clients worldwide.

What You’ll Do

  • Own functional strategy and end‑to‑end delivery for key components of the Client Onboarding platform. Lead functional blueprinting and requirements definition to enhance digital onboarding capabilities

  • Act as a senior liaison between business, operations, product, and engineering teams, ensuring functional solutions align to business priorities and regulatory expectations

  • Drive backlog ownership, prioritization, functional testing, and production readiness to support reliable releases and continuous improvement

  • Evaluate complex onboarding processes to identify and implement solutions that reduce manual effort, operational risk, and cost

  • Provide functional leadership across web portals, Application Programming Interface (APIs), and workflow tools supporting both internal users and external clients

Skills You’ll Need

  • Bachelor’s degree or extensive equivalent experience in technology, business systems, or functional delivery

  • Proven ability to solve complex business and operational challenges through structured analysis and functional solution design

  • Strong track record of owning functional scope and delivering measurable outcomes in fast‑paced, delivery‑focused environments Experience working within Agile delivery models, including close collaboration with technology teams

  • Advanced expertise in functional requirements leadership, producing clear Epics, Features, and User Stories that drive high‑quality implementation
